Agi Szentannai (Budapest, HUN) finished 0-5 in the 18-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Szentannai lost 7-6 to Sarah Mueller (Biel, SUI), droppimg another game, 9-2 to Liudmila Privivkova (Moscow, RUS). Szentannai lost 9-3 to Eirin Mesloe (Oslo, NOR). Szentannai lost 5-4 to Tene Link (Tallinn, EST). Szentannai lost 6-3 to Eve Muirhead (Stirling, UK) in their final qualifying round match.
. For week 15 of the event schedule, Szentannai did not improve upon their best events, dropping from 201st to 205th place overall on the World Ranking Standings with 1.910 total points. Szentannai ranks 135th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 1.910 points earned so far this season.
